Omron E2E-X1R5B28 5M Inductive Proximity Sensor
| Feature | Value |
|---|---|
| Sensor Category | Inductive Proximity Sensor |
| Series | E2E NEXT |
| Housing Size | M8 Threaded |
| Mounting Configuration | Flush Shielded |
| Sensing Distance | 1.5 mm |
| Output Configuration | PNP Normally Open |
| Supply Voltage | 10 to 30 VDC |
| Cable Length | 5 m |
| Housing Material | Stainless Steel |
| Protection Class | IP67 / IP69K |
| Response Frequency | 1 kHz |
| Operating Temperature | -25°C to +70°C |

Technical Description
The Omron E2E-X1R5B28 5M Inductive Proximity Sensor is an M8 threaded inductive sensor developed for detecting metallic objects without physical contact. The sensor provides a sensing distance of 1.5 mm and incorporates a PNP normally open output compatible with many industrial control platforms.
The integrated 5-meter cable supports installations where control cabinets and junction points are located farther from the sensing position. The stainless-steel housing provides mechanical protection and resistance against challenging industrial conditions.
Operating Principle
The sensor continuously generates an electromagnetic field through its sensing face. When a metallic object approaches the active area, induced eddy currents modify the oscillator characteristics inside the sensor. This change is detected by the electronic circuitry, which switches the output state.
Because detection occurs without mechanical contact, the sensor can operate with minimal wear and reduced maintenance requirements.

Industrial Applications
The Omron E2E-X1R5B28 5M Inductive Proximity Sensor can be installed on conveyor systems to detect metal carriers and transport mechanisms. In automated assembly equipment, it may be used for position monitoring of fixtures, clamps, and metallic machine components.
Machine builders frequently select longer cable versions when sensors must be mounted at significant distances from control cabinets. The 5-meter cable helps reduce the need for additional extension wiring.
In metal fabrication facilities, the sensor can support automated positioning systems and machine sequencing operations.
